The Powerball drawing on Wednesday night did not yield any grand prize winner for the estimated $40 million jackpot with a cash value of $28.1 million.

The next Powerball drawing will take place on Saturday and will see the jackpot grow to an estimated $52 million with a $36.6 million cash option.

The winning lottery numbers drawn on Wednesday, June 16, were 19, 29, 34, 44, 50 with a red Powerball of 25. The Power Play was 2X.

Although no grand prize winners resulted from the latest drawing, there were several smaller monetary wins from the night. There were seven players that hit the Match 4 plus red Powerball, winning $50,000 each.

Meanwhile, four players won the Match 4 plus red Powerball with the Power Play and won $100,000 each.

However, there were no instant millionaires following the Wednesday night drawing. Players who hit the Match 5 win $1 million, whereas players who win the Match 5 with a Power Play go home with $2 million.

The rest of the monetary winnings from the latest drawing ranged between $4 and $200.

The last Powerball jackpot was won on Saturday, June 5 when a player from Florida won the $285.6 million grand prize.

The next Powerball drawing will be held at 10:59 p.m. on Saturday. The lottery can be played in 45 states, including Washington, D.C., the U.S. Virgin Islands, and Puerto Rico.
